今天给各位分享原生js设置css样式的知识,其中也会对原生js设置属性进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
- 1、js点击改变当前菜单css样式
- 2、js修改css等前端样式
- 3、js改变css样式
- 4、原生小程序开发中如何实现元素流畅循环向上移动并消失的动画效果...
- 5、建站知识:如何使用 *** 来自由切换css样式表
- 6、怎么在js中给文本框添加CSS样式
js点击改变当前菜单css样式
直接修改元素的 style 属性适用于快速调整单个元素的特定样式,优先级高于外部样式表。
详细 *** 如下:之一步:在连接样式表的元素里定义一个id,例如我定义的id是css。
如:a.className=class名;这行代码将id为id的元素的类名设置为class名,浏览器会根据当前加载的CSS文件中的样式规则来重新渲染该元素,以实现样式改变的效果。这种动态改变样式的 *** 在前端开发中非常常见,可以灵活地控制页面布局和视觉效果,为用户提供更好的交互体验。
在JavaScript中修改CSS样式可以通过多种方式实现,包括直接操作元素的style属性、使用classList添加/移除类,或通过jQuery的.css() *** 。
需转换为数组后使用 forEach。 通过 querySelector() 修改首个匹配选择器的元素适用场景:精准选择之一个匹配复杂 CSS 选择器的元素(如类、属性等)。
js修改css等前端样式
直接修改内联样式,优先级较高(仅次于!important)。适合动态调整单个样式属性。
在JavaScript中,我们可以直接操作DOM元素的样式属性来改变页面元素的外观。例如,我们可以通过获取id为id的DOM节点,然后改变其颜 为红 。示例代码如下://先获取dom节点 var a = document.getElementById(id);a.style.color=red; //改变颜 这行代码将id为id的元素字体颜 设置为红 。
内联样式修改 使用style属性:通过元素的style属性来操作内联样式,style属性返回CSSStyleDeclaration对象。 设置样式:例如,element.style.color = red;对于包含“”的CSS属性,如webkittextstroke,可通过element.style[webkittextstroke]访问。
点击我此属性可通过JavaScript动态修改,作为触发样式变化的“开关”。
选择 CSS-in- *** 库并安装常用库:styled-components、emotion、 *** S,均支持动态样式和主题管理。以 styled-components 为例:npm install styled-components 基于 Props 动态调整样式通过模板字符串和 props 函数,根据组件属性实时改变样式。示例:按钮组件根据 primary 属性切换背景 。
js改变css样式
直接修改内联样式,优先级较高(仅次于!important)。适合动态调整单个样式属性。
在JavaScript中,我们可以直接操作DOM元素的样式属性来改变页面元素的外观。例如,我们可以通过获取id为id的DOM节点,然后改变其颜 为红 。示例代码如下://先获取dom节点 var a = document.getElementById(id);a.style.color=red; //改变颜 这行代码将id为id的元素字体颜 设置为红 。
通过 getElementById() 修改特定 ID 元素的样式适用场景:修改页面中 ID 元素的样式。
独立的样式修改 切换 className 或 classList通过切换 CSS 类名批量应用样式,便于维护和复用。
通过 JavaScript 设置 CSS 样式可通过直接操作内联样式、管理类名或修改 CSS 变量实现,具体需结合场景选择合适 *** 。 以下是详细操作指南:直接操作内联样式通过 DOM 元素的 style 属性直接修改内联样式,优先级较高(低于 !important)。
详细 *** 如下:之一步:在连接样式表的元素里定义一个id,例如我定义的id是css。
原生小程序开发中如何实现元素流畅循环向上移动并消失的动画效果...
1、移除消失元素 检查元素是否已移动至顶部(translateY为负值),若超出容器则移除。
2、微信小程序圆形波浪循环效果,是通过SVG(可缩放矢量图形)和CSS3动画技术实现的。具体来说,是通过创建一个SVG的圆形路径,然后利用CSS3的动画来对圆形路径进行填充来实现的。
3、动画性能:使用 requestAnimationFrame 替代 setTimeout(小程序中可用 wx.createSelectorQuery 优化)。
4、向上滚动:若用户向上滚动且搜索框被遮挡不足临界值,松手后显示搜索框。从底部上滑:需额外判断滚动方向,避免搜索框意外显示。可通过记录上一次滚动位置(lastScrollTop)实现:若当前scrollTop lastScrollTop,则为向下滚动;若当前scrollTop lastScrollTop,则为向上滚动。
5、创建自定义tabbar组件:在小程序项目中创建一个自定义组件,例如custom-tab-bar。
6、进入小程序管理界面首先打开聊天应用,点击底部导航栏的“发现”选项。
建站知识:如何使用 *** 来自由切换css样式表
详细 *** 如下:之一步:在连接样式表的元素里定义一个id,例如link href=css rel=stylesheet type=text/css id=css我定义的id是css。
需转换为数组后使用 forEach。 通过 querySelector() 修改首个匹配选择器的元素适用场景:精准选择之一个匹配复杂 CSS 选择器的元素(如类、属性等)。
直接修改元素的 style 属性适用于快速调整单个元素的特定样式,优先级高于外部样式表。
在JavaScript中修改CSS样式可以通过多种方式实现,包括直接操作元素的style属性、使用classList添加/移除类,或通过jQuery的.css() *** 。
属性名需转换为驼峰式(如 backgroundColor 替代 background-color)。内联样式优先级较高,会覆盖外部样式表中的定义。 使用 innerHTML 动态插入样式表通过修改 标签的内容或创建新样式规则。
//先获取dom节点 var a = document.getElementById(id);a.style.color=red; //改变颜 这行代码将id为id的元素字体颜 设置为红 。
怎么在js中给文本框添加CSS样式
1、动态添加样式表通过创建一个新的元素,并将其附加到文档头部,可以动态添加CSS样式。
2、外部样式 当样式需要应用于很多页面时,外部样式表将是理想的选择。在使用外部样式表的情况下,你可以通过改变一个文件来改变整个站点的外观。每个页面使用标签链接到样式表。标签在(文档的)头部: 内部样式 当单个文档需要特殊的样式时,就应该使用内部样式表。
3、在JavaScript中修改CSS样式可以通过多种方式实现,包括直接操作元素的style属性、使用classList添加/移除类,或通过jQuery的.css() *** 。
4、HTML 结构 示例文字 JavaScript 代码 定义三个函数,分别为 fun1()、fun2() 和 fun3(),分别用于将文本对齐方式设置为左、中、右。
5、独立的样式修改 切换 className 或 classList通过切换 CSS 类名批量应用样式,便于维护和复用。
6、关键注意事项样式命名规则:JavaScript 中 CSS 属性名需转为驼峰式(如 backgroundColor 替代 background-color)。性能优化:频繁操作样式时,建议通过修改 className 或 classList 切换预定义 CSS 类,而非直接操作 style。
关于原生js设置css样式和原生js设置属性的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。
![前端开发技术大全 | 最新教程、实战项目、资源下载 - [米特尔科技]](http://www.hdmte.com/zb_users/theme/quietlee/style/images/logo.png)
![前端开发技术大全 | 最新教程、实战项目、资源下载 - [米特尔科技]](http://www.hdmte.com/zb_users/theme/quietlee/style/images/yjlogo.png)


